Accéder au contenu principal Passer au contenu complémentaire

Centralisation des métadonnées Snowflake

Utilisez l'assistant de métadonnées Snowflake pour vous connecter à Snowflake et récupérer les schémas de table.

Pourquoi et quand exécuter cette tâche

Note InformationsRemarque :

L'assistant de métadonnées Snowflake ne supporte pas les vues Snowflake.

Procédure

  1. Dans la vue en arborescence Repository (Référentiel), développez le nœud Metadata (Métadonnées), cliquez-droit sur Db Connections (Connexions Db) et cliquez sur Create connection (Créer une connexion).
    Option Create connection (Créer une connexion) sélectionnée via un clic-droit.
  2. Sélectionnez Snowflake dans la liste et cliquez sur Finish (Terminer).
  3. Dans la boîte de dialogue Create (Créer) Snowflake, saisissez un nom pour la connexion et cliquez sur Next (Suivant).
    Boîte de dialogue Create (Créer) Snowflake.
  4. Spécifiez les paramètres de connexion suivants :
    • Account : saisissez le nom du compte qui vous a été assigné par Snowflake.
    • User ID : saisissez votre ID d'utilisateur Snowflake.
    • Password : saisissez le mot de passe associé à l'identifiant de l'utilisateur ou de l'utilisatrice.
    • Warehouse : saisissez le nom de l'entrepôt Snowflake.
    • Schéma : saisissez le nom du schéma de la base de données.
    • Database : saisissez le nom de la base de données Snowflake.
    Note InformationsRemarque :

    Dans Snowflake, les noms de Warehouse, Schema et Database sont sensibles à la casse et généralement en lettres majuscules.

  5. Cliquez sur Check connection (Vérifier la connexion) pour vérifier la configuration.
    Si les informations de connexion sont correctes, une boîte de dialogue de confirmation apparaît. Cliquez sur OK pour fermer cette boîte de dialogue.
  6. Cliquez sur Next (Suivant).
  7. Spécifiez ou mettez à jour les valeurs des propriétés avancées suivantes et cliquez sur Finish (Terminer) pour fermer la boîte de dialogue.
    Boîte de dialogue Edit (Modifier) Snowflake.
    • Login Timeout : spécifiez le temps d'attente d'une réponse lors de la connexion à Snowflake, avant de retourner une erreur.
    • Tracing : sélectionnez le niveau de log pour le pilote JDBC de Snowflake. Si cette option est activée, un log standard Java est généré.
    • Role : saisissez le rôle de contrôle des accès par défaut à utiliser pour initialiser la session Snowflake.

      Ce rôle doit déjà exister et doit avoir été assigné à l'ID de l'utilisateur ou de l'utilisatrice que vous utilisez pour vous connecter Snowflake. Si vous laissez ce champ vide, le rôle PUBLIC est automatiquement assigné. Pour plus d'informations concernant le modèle de contrôle des accès Snowflake, consultez Comprendre le modèle de contrôle des accès (uniquement en anglais) (en anglais).

    La nouvelle connexion à Snowflake créée s'affiche sous Snowflake dans le nœud Db Connections (Connexions Db) de la vue en arborescence Repository (Référentiel), de même que les schémas des tables récupérées.
  8. Cliquez-droit sur la connexion Snowflake, puis cliquez sur Retrieve schema (Récupérer le schéma) pour sélectionner les tables à inclure.
    Option Retrieve schema (Récupérer le schéma).
  9. Dans la boîte de dialogue Filter for the Table (Filtre de la table), définissez les conditions de filtre et cliquez sur Next (Suivant).
  10. Sélectionnez les tables dont vous souhaitez récupérer le schéma et cliquez sur Next (Suivant).
    Boîte de dialogue Select Schema to create (Sélectionner le schéma à créer.
  11. Modifiez les schémas de table et cliquez sur Finish (Terminer).
    Boîte de dialogue Add a Schema on repository (Ajouter un schéma sur le référentiel).

Résultats

Vous pouvez ajouter un composant Snowflake dans l'espace de modélisation graphique en glissant-déposant la connexion à Snowflake ou n’importe quelle table récupérée depuis la vue Repository (Référentiel) afin de réutiliser la connexion ou les informations du schéma. Pour plus d'informations, consultez Comment utiliser les métadonnées centralisées dans un Job et la documentation sur les composants Snowflake associée.

Dans la vue en arborescence Repository (Référentiel), vous pouvez également effectuer les opérations suivantes :

  • Pour modifier la connexion, cliquez-droit sur le nœud de connexion sous Db Connections (Connexions Db) et sélectionner Edit this (Modifier cet élément) Snowflake dans le menu contextuel.
  • Pour modifier un schéma de table, cliquez-droit sur le noeud de table et sélectionnez Edit schéma (Modifier le schéma) dans le menu contextuel.

Cette page vous a-t-elle aidé ?

Si vous rencontrez des problèmes sur cette page ou dans son contenu – une faute de frappe, une étape manquante ou une erreur technique – faites-le-nous savoir.